This course will demonstrate the application of soft tissue assessment principles and techniques. This will include initial interview and history documentation, accurate orthopedic assessment, and analysis of assessment findings with respect to the general principles of anatomy, physiology, and pathology. Students will learn to apply and expand charting skills to document assessment findings. Understanding the principles of assessment, and accurately performing appropriate assessment techniques will be emphasized.
